Wonkhe: The major review of HE finance must focus on the real problems
Published on January 9, 2018
University Alliance Chief Executive Maddalaine Ansell has written a piece for Wonkhe about the government’s major review of higher education funding.
Maddalaine writes that the government needs to be brave enough to use the review to focus on the real problems.
“In relation to mature learners, we saw a further drop of 40% in applications this year. As many mature students used to study at Levels 4 and 5, there has been a decline in demand for these courses and an increase in complaints from employers that they cannot recruit sufficient people at this level.”
